Location: Wallsend, Tyne and Wear
Hadrian’s Wall Path stretches for nearly 84 miles and is a must for outdoor enthusiasts. The full trail runs from Wallsend through Newcastle-upon-Tyne to Bowness-on-Solway, but shorter sections make it easy to enjoy some of the most scenic landscapes in northern England at your own pace.
Travel tip: Visit in late spring or early fall to enjoy great weather while avoiding the larger hiking crowds of summer.
Best time to visit: May–October ✦ Budget: $
Location: Bournemouth, Dorset
Step into 185 million years of history along England’s Jurassic Coast—right from Bournemouth. This 95-mile stretch is the only place on Earth where you’ll find exposed rock formations from the Triassic, Jurassic, and Cretaceous periods all in one place.
Hop aboard a modern sightseeing boat and cruise past dramatic white chalk cliffs, secluded coves, and charming seaside villages from Poole Harbour to Swanage. Don’t forget your camera—Old Harry Rocks offers one of the most iconic views on the coast.
Best time to visit: April–October ✦ Budget: $

Location: Stratford-upon-Avon
Located about 100 miles northwest of London, Stratford-upon-Avon is the birthplace of William Shakespeare, born in 1564. Explore this charming town at your own pace and dive into the fascinating story of the world’s most famous playwright with the Shakespeare Story Ticket.
Visit his birthplace on Henley Street, stroll through Anne Hathaway’s Cottage, and explore Mary Arden’s Farm. Walk to the historic Holy Trinity Church, and cap off your visit with a performance of a classic like The Merry Wives of Windsor at the Royal Shakespeare Theatre.
Best time to visit: Year-round ✦ Budget: $
